Design Changes

The Galaxy S25 Ultra is likely to have a slightly bigger screen than the previous versions. It may grow from 6.8 inches to about 6.9 inches. The frame will be made of aluminum, and the front and back will feature Gorilla Glass Victus 2. This will help protect the phone from drops and scratches.

The phone will also have an IP68 and IP69 rating for water and dust resistance. This means you can take it to the beach or the pool without worrying too much.

One of the biggest changes is in the corners of the phone. The corners will be more rounded compared to the last model. This will make it more comfortable to hold. Many users found the sharp corners of the previous models uncomfortable. So, this change is a great improvement!

Performance Upgrades

Now, let’s talk about performance. The Galaxy S25 Ultra is expected to use the Exynos 2500 processor or the Snapdragon 8 Gen 4. This new chip should help with better performance and less heating during use. Last year’s model had some heating issues, especially during gaming or camera use. The new processor aims to solve these problems.

It will come with options for 8GB or 12GB of RAM. This means you can run many apps at once without slowing down. The storage options will likely be 256GB, 512GB, and 1TB, which is a lot of space for photos, videos, and apps. The phone will run on the latest Android version, ensuring you have all the new features and security updates.

Camera Features

Let’s get to the camera! The Galaxy S25 Ultra will have a powerful camera setup. There is talk of a 50MP main camera with 2x optical zoom and a 12MP ultra-wide camera. This is similar to last year’s model, but it might have some improvements in low-light performance.

For video lovers, it will support 8K video recording at 30fps, which is impressive. You’ll be able to capture stunning videos with great detail.

There are also rumors of new camera designs that will make taking photos even more fun. The camera module may have a round design, giving it a fresh look.

Battery Life

Battery life is always a big concern. The Galaxy S25 Ultra may have a battery capacity of around 5500mAh, which is an increase from last year’s 5000mAh. This means you can use your phone longer without needing to charge it.

The charging speed will likely remain at 45 watts. This is fast enough to quickly charge your phone when you need it most.

Software and Features

The software experience will also be better. Samsung plans to include a new UI that will make the phone feel faster and more responsive. You’ll be able to rearrange apps and customize your experience even more.

Another exciting feature is the S Pen. There might be changes to the design of the S Pen to make it blend better with the phone. This will make it easier to use for drawing or taking notes.

Pricing and Availability

As for the price, the Galaxy S25 Ultra will likely start at around $1,299.99. There might be some promotions that could lower the price a bit. However, expect a slight increase compared to last year’s model due to the new features and improvements.

The phone is expected to be available in January 2025, so keep an eye out for the official release date!
